Output ef12b91220e2a3763d97868a26a1253a0183aeedf29049e5e68692b24b7dbb3b:1

value
9594180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6228d7e99ba1518688264a3a825bc7fe0c9aad79 OP_EQUAL
address
3Ae35C9A1X7zAmwehVxcNyrD7822pvVGnW
transaction
ef12b91220e2a3763d97868a26a1253a0183aeedf29049e5e68692b24b7dbb3b
confirmations
475715
spent
true